当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储百度百科,深入浅出对象存储,实战指南与最佳实践解析

对象存储百度百科,深入浅出对象存储,实战指南与最佳实践解析

对象存储百度百科深入浅出介绍对象存储概念,实战指南与最佳实践解析,助您轻松掌握对象存储技术。...

对象存储百度百科深入浅出介绍对象存储概念,实战指南与最佳实践解析,助您轻松掌握对象存储技术。

随着互联网技术的飞速发展,数据量呈爆炸式增长,如何高效、安全地存储海量数据成为企业面临的重要挑战,对象存储作为一种新兴的存储技术,以其高效、灵活、可扩展等优势,逐渐成为大数据、云计算等领域的首选存储方案,本文将深入浅出地介绍对象存储的概念、原理、应用场景,并结合实际案例,为您呈现一份全面的对象存储实战指南。

对象存储概述

定义

对象存储百度百科,深入浅出对象存储,实战指南与最佳实践解析

图片来源于网络,如有侵权联系删除

对象存储(Object Storage)是一种基于文件系统的分布式存储技术,它将数据存储为一个个独立的对象,每个对象包含数据本身、元数据和唯一标识符,对象存储系统通常由存储节点、管理节点和客户端组成,通过HTTP/HTTPS协议进行数据访问。

特点

(1)高效:对象存储采用分布式架构,可横向扩展,有效提高存储性能。

(2)灵活:对象存储支持多种数据格式,如文本、图片、视频等,可满足不同场景下的存储需求。

(3)可扩展:对象存储系统可根据业务需求进行横向扩展,满足海量数据的存储需求。

(4)安全:对象存储系统提供数据加密、访问控制等功能,确保数据安全。

应用场景

(1)大数据:对象存储可存储海量数据,适用于大数据处理和分析。

(2)云计算:对象存储是云计算平台的核心组成部分,可提供海量、高效、安全的存储服务。

(3)视频点播:对象存储可存储大量视频文件,满足视频点播业务需求。

(4)云存储:对象存储为云存储提供底层存储支持,提高数据存储效率。

对象存储原理

存储节点

存储节点是对象存储系统的基本单元,负责存储数据,每个存储节点包含存储设备和相应的管理软件。

管理节点

管理节点负责对象存储系统的管理和调度,主要功能包括:

(1)数据存储:将数据分配到合适的存储节点进行存储。

(2)数据备份:对数据进行备份,确保数据安全。

(3)数据恢复:在数据丢失或损坏时,进行数据恢复。

(4)数据迁移:根据业务需求,将数据迁移到其他存储节点。

客户端

客户端负责向对象存储系统发送请求,获取数据,客户端可以是应用程序、服务器或终端设备。

数据访问

客户端通过HTTP/HTTPS协议向对象存储系统发送请求,请求格式包括:

对象存储百度百科,深入浅出对象存储,实战指南与最佳实践解析

图片来源于网络,如有侵权联系删除

(1)GET:获取对象数据。

(2)PUT:上传对象数据。

(3)DELETE:删除对象数据。

(4)HEAD:获取对象元数据。

对象存储实战案例

大数据场景

某互联网公司采用对象存储系统存储海量日志数据,通过分布式架构提高数据存储性能,利用对象存储系统的数据备份功能,确保数据安全。

云计算场景

某云计算平台采用对象存储系统作为底层存储方案,为用户提供海量、高效、安全的存储服务,用户可通过HTTP/HTTPS协议访问对象存储系统,实现数据存储、访问和共享。

视频点播场景

某视频点播平台采用对象存储系统存储海量视频文件,通过分布式架构提高视频播放性能,利用对象存储系统的数据加密功能,确保用户隐私安全。

对象存储最佳实践

选择合适的对象存储系统

根据业务需求,选择具有高性能、高可靠性和可扩展性的对象存储系统。

数据分区与存储节点分配

合理划分数据分区,将数据分配到合适的存储节点,提高数据存储性能。

数据备份与恢复

定期进行数据备份,确保数据安全,在数据丢失或损坏时,及时进行数据恢复。

数据访问控制

设置合理的访问控制策略,确保数据安全。

监控与优化

实时监控对象存储系统性能,及时发现并解决潜在问题。

对象存储作为一种新兴的存储技术,具有高效、灵活、可扩展等优势,在众多领域得到广泛应用,本文深入浅出地介绍了对象存储的概念、原理、应用场景和实战案例,并结合最佳实践,为您呈现一份全面的对象存储实战指南,希望本文能帮助您更好地了解和应用对象存储技术。

黑狐家游戏

发表评论

最新文章